Bug description:
Binary package hint: gbrainy

Affected version: 1.50

"John's age is nowadays 2 times his son's age. 18 years ago, John was 5 times older than his son. How old is John's son nowadays?"

Gbrainy says that correct answer is 40 (on the attached screenshot), but it isn't true. If nowadays John's son is 40, then John is 80 (2x). 18 years ago John's son was 22 and John was 62 (2.8x, which is incorrect statement).

Puzzle can be solved, using simple equation. Let son's age nowadays will be x, than John's age will be 2*x. 18 years ago: 2*x-18=5*(x-18). From this x=24. Nowadays, John's son is 24 and John himself is 48 (2x), 18 years ago John's son was 6 and John was 30 (5x).

Correct answer must be 24, not 40.
